Frequently Asked Questions About Dash Cams
Q1: Why do I need a front and rear dash cam?
A front and rear dash cam provides comprehensive coverage, capturing events not only in front of your vehicle but also behind it. This dual protection is crucial for collecting evidence in rear-end collisions, hit-and-runs while parked, or capturing road rage incidents from both directions, offering much greater peace of mind.
Q2: Is it legal to use a dash cam in my car?
In most countries and U.S. states, it is perfectly legal to use a dash cam for personal use. However, laws regarding audio recording, placement (to avoid obstructing driver’s view), and privacy (especially concerning internal cameras or sharing footage publicly) can vary. Always check your local regulations to ensure compliance.
Q3: What is “parking mode” and do I need it?
Parking mode allows your dash cam to continue monitoring your vehicle even when it’s turned off. It typically uses motion detection or G-sensor (impact detection) to automatically start recording if someone bumps your car or attempts to vandalize it. If you park in public places or are concerned about incidents while away from your vehicle, parking mode is an incredibly valuable feature.
Q4: Do all dash cams come with GPS and Wi-Fi?
No, not all dash cams include both GPS and Wi-Fi. GPS allows the camera to record your speed, location, and driving route, which can be crucial evidence. Wi-Fi enables you to connect the dash cam to your smartphone via an app, making it easy to view, download, and share footage without removing the SD card. These are premium features that often come with higher-end models.
Q5: How do dash cams handle memory storage with “loop recording”?
Loop recording is a standard feature in almost all dash cams. When your memory card is full, the dash cam automatically overwrites the oldest footage with new recordings. This ensures continuous recording without you having to manually clear the card. Important recordings triggered by the G-sensor (like an impact) are usually “locked” and protected from being overwritten.
Q6: Do I need to hardwire my dash cam for parking mode?
For continuous 24/7 parking mode surveillance, a hardwire kit is almost always required. This kit connects your dash cam directly to your car’s fuse box, providing constant power without draining your car’s battery (it usually has low-voltage protection). Without it, parking mode might only work for a limited time (if the dash cam has a small internal battery) or not at all.
Q7: What resolution is best for a dash cam?
For the front camera, 4K (3840x2160P) offers the best detail, allowing you to clearly read license plates and road signs, even from a distance. For the rear camera, 1080P (1920x1080P) is generally sufficient for clear evidence, though 2K (2560x1440P) offers even more clarity. Higher resolution usually means larger file sizes, so ensure you have a large enough SD card.
